概括
环境因素对Moso竹汁流产生了影响,照明和温度促进了这种影响,而二氧化碳和湿度则抑制了这种影响. 这项研究揭示了竹水发汗的复杂因果关系和时间滞后.
科学领域:
- 植物生理学
- 环境科学
- 生态学
背景情况:
- 了解莫索竹汁流对于其水透模式至关重要.
- 传统的相关性分析缺乏因果推理,限制了机理学理解.
- 确定环境因素与液液流之间的因果关系至关重要.
研究的目的:
- 阐明主要环境因素如何影响莫索竹汁流的因果机制.
- 在液流动力学中区分相关性和因果关系.
- 为分析环境与液流相互作用提供一种新的方法框架.
主要方法:
- 使用快速因果推断算法来确定非时间因果关系.
- 使用隐藏的彼得 - 克拉克瞬间条件独立算法对时间因果效应.
- 分析了Moso竹汁流与关键环境因素之间的因果关系.
主要成果:
- 即使在灰色系数较低的情况下也确定了因果关系.
- 照明,空气和土壤的温度促进了液液的密度.
- 二氧化碳度,空气湿度和土壤温度阻碍了液液流动密度,时间的延迟有所不同 (20-80分钟).
结论:
- 建立了一个新的因果框架来分析环境因素对Moso竹汁流的影响.
- 证明照明具有最长的延迟效果 (大约2小时). 80分钟),而二氧化碳和土壤湿度具有快速效应 (约. 20分钟) 的时间.
- 提供了对Moso竹水使用动态的更深入的了解, 并推动了植物生理学研究.

Adaptations that Reduce Water Loss
26.3K
Though evaporation from plant leaves drives transpiration, it also results in loss of water. Because water is critical for photosynthetic reactions and other cellular processes, evolutionary pressures on plants in different environments have driven the acquisition of adaptations that reduce water loss.

Xylem and Transpiration-driven Transport of Resources
24.6K
The xylem of vascular plants distributes water and dissolved minerals that are taken up by the roots to the rest of the plant. The cells that transport xylem sap are dead upon maturity, and the movement of xylem sap is a passive process.
